Component Instance State

같은 atom state 정의를 여러 UI 인스턴스가 독립적으로 쓰도록 instanceId별 atom family로 분리하는 패턴이다.

핵심은 one state definition, many isolated instances다.

1. 모듈 코드

  • src/modules/ui/utilities/state/component-state/utils/createComponentInstanceContext.ts: subtree에서 component instance id를 전달할 Context를 만든다.
  • src/modules/ui/utilities/state/component-state/hooks/useAvailableComponentInstanceIdOrThrow.ts: props로 받은 id를 우선하고, 없으면 context id를 사용한다.
  • src/modules/ui/utilities/state/jotai/utils/createAtomComponentState.ts: instanceId마다 별도 Jotai atom을 캐싱해서 반환한다.
// filepath: src/modules/ui/utilities/state/component-state/utils/createComponentInstanceContext.ts
import { type ComponentInstanceStateContext } from '@/ui/utilities/state/component-state/types/ComponentInstanceStateContext';
import { type ComponentStateKey } from '@/ui/utilities/state/component-state/types/ComponentStateKey';
import { createContext } from 'react';

export const createComponentInstanceContext = <
T extends ComponentStateKey = ComponentStateKey,
>(
initialValue?: T,
) => {
return createContext<T | null>(
initialValue ?? null,
) as ComponentInstanceStateContext<T>;
};

// filepath: src/modules/ui/utilities/state/component-state/hooks/useAvailableComponentInstanceIdOrThrow.ts
import { useComponentInstanceStateContext } from '@/ui/utilities/state/component-state/hooks/useComponentInstanceStateContext';
import { type ComponentInstanceStateContext } from '@/ui/utilities/state/component-state/types/ComponentInstanceStateContext';
import { isNonEmptyString } from '@sniptt/guards';

export const useAvailableComponentInstanceIdOrThrow = <
T extends { instanceId: string },
>(
Context: ComponentInstanceStateContext<T>,
instanceIdFromProps?: string,
): string => {
const instanceStateContext = useComponentInstanceStateContext(Context);
const instanceIdFromContext = instanceStateContext?.instanceId;

if (isNonEmptyString(instanceIdFromProps)) {
return instanceIdFromProps;
} else if (isNonEmptyString(instanceIdFromContext)) {
return instanceIdFromContext;
} else {
throw new Error(
'Instance id is not provided and cannot be found in context.',
);
}
};

// filepath: src/modules/ui/utilities/state/jotai/utils/createAtomComponentState.ts
import { type ComponentInstanceStateContext } from '@/ui/utilities/state/component-state/types/ComponentInstanceStateContext';
import { type ComponentStateKey } from '@/ui/utilities/state/component-state/types/ComponentStateKey';
import { globalComponentInstanceContextMap } from '@/ui/utilities/state/component-state/utils/globalComponentInstanceContextMap';
import { type ComponentState } from '@/ui/utilities/state/jotai/types/ComponentState';
import { atom } from 'jotai';
import { isDefined } from 'twenty-shared/utils';

export const createAtomComponentState = <ValueType>({
key,
defaultValue,
componentInstanceContext,
}: {
key: string;
defaultValue: ValueType;
componentInstanceContext: ComponentInstanceStateContext<any> | null;
}): ComponentState<ValueType> => {
if (isDefined(componentInstanceContext)) {
globalComponentInstanceContextMap.set(key, componentInstanceContext);
}

const atomCache = new Map<
string,
ReturnType<ComponentState<ValueType>['atomFamily']>
>();

const familyFunction = ({
instanceId,
}: ComponentStateKey): ReturnType<
ComponentState<ValueType>['atomFamily']
> => {
const existing = atomCache.get(instanceId);

if (existing !== undefined) {
return existing;
}

const baseAtom = atom(defaultValue);
baseAtom.debugLabel = `${key}__${instanceId}`;
atomCache.set(instanceId, baseAtom);

return baseAtom;
};

return {
type: 'ComponentState',
key,
atomFamily: familyFunction,
};
};

2. 사용 예제

import { createComponentInstanceContext } from '@/ui/utilities/state/component-state/utils/createComponentInstanceContext';
import { createAtomComponentState } from '@/ui/utilities/state/jotai/utils/createAtomComponentState';
import { useAtomComponentState } from '@/ui/utilities/state/jotai/hooks/useAtomComponentState';

export const PanelComponentInstanceContext = createComponentInstanceContext();

export const panelIsOpenComponentState = createAtomComponentState<boolean>({
key: 'panelIsOpenComponentState',
defaultValue: false,
componentInstanceContext: PanelComponentInstanceContext,
});

export const Panel = ({
panelInstanceId,
}: {
panelInstanceId: string;
}) => {
return (
<PanelComponentInstanceContext.Provider
value={{ instanceId: panelInstanceId }}
>
<PanelContent />
</PanelComponentInstanceContext.Provider>
);
};

export const PanelContent = () => {
const [isOpen, setIsOpen] = useAtomComponentState(panelIsOpenComponentState);

return (
<button onClick={() => setIsOpen(!isOpen)}>
{isOpen ? 'Close' : 'Open'}
</button>
);
};
